1912: WHITE CITY DEBAUCHERY
IN THE FALL I WILL BE DOING A KUSER MANSION PROGRAM ON WHITE CITY, "THE CONEY ISLAND OF NEW JERSEY." EVEN THOUGH WHITE CITY WAS A GLAMOROUS AMUSEMENT PARK, THROUGHOUT ITS EXISTANCE IT WAS CONSTANTLY INVOLVED VIOLATIONS OF THE "BLUE LAWS," WHICH MANDATED CLOSING ON SUNDAYS. THERE WERE ALSO MANY INCIDENTS SUCH AS THE GRAPHIC ABOVE, WHERE LADIES WITH QUESTIONABLE MORALS HELD FORTH.
